Virginia 529 Distribution being taxed

I entered the 1099-Q and 1098-T in Turbo Tax Premier.  The tuition on the 1098-T was $6 more than the distribution on the 1099-Q.  Therefore, the 1099-Q is more than offset by tuition.  There were no scholarships and no other distributions.  In the section where it asks who the 1099-Q was for, if I enter the beneficiary, same as the recipient/beneficiary/student, it taxes the earnings amount from the 1099-Q.  If I enter that the 1099-Q went to someone else, the 1099-Q is no longer taxable.  This appears to be an error in the program as it should be non-taxable for the recipient/beneficiary/student and taxable for someone else.  I cannot figure out how to report this.  

If not, can someone please explain why the beneficiary/recipient/student is being taxed when the tuition offsets the distribution.  This is the student's tax form.
